Permanent ethernet MAC address
|
||||
-------------------------------
|
||||
Prior flashing new U-Boot version (as part of ATF image) it is suggested to backup
|
||||
permanent ethernet MAC address as it is stored only in U-Boot env storage (SPI or eMMC).
|
||||
Some boards like EspressoBin have MAC address printed on sticker. To print current MAC
|
||||
address run:
|
||||
permanent ethernet MAC addresses as they are stored only in U-Boot env storage (SPI or eMMC).
|
||||
Some boards like EspressoBin have MAC addresses printed on sticker. Some boards got assigned
|
||||
only one address other may also more than one. To print current MAC addresses run:
|
||||
|
||||
# echo $ethaddr
|
||||
# echo $eth1addr
|
||||
# echo $eth2addr
|
||||
# echo $eth3addr
|
||||
# ...
|
||||
|
||||
MAC addresses 00:51:82:11:22:00, 00:51:82:11:22:01, 00:51:82:11:22:02, 00:51:82:11:22:03
|
||||
and F0:AD:4E:03:64:7F are default hardcoded values found in Marvell's and Armbian U-Boot

After flashing new U-Boot version it is suggested to reset U-Boot env variables to default
|
||||
and then set correct permanent ethernet MAC address.
|
||||
and then set correct permanent ethernet MAC addresses.
|
||||
|
||||
# env default -a
|
||||
# setenv ethaddr XX:XX:XX:XX:XX:XX
|
||||
# setenv eth1addr XX:XX:XX:XX:XX:XX
|
||||
# setenv eth2addr YY:YY:YY:YY:YY:YY
|
||||
# setenv eth3addr ZZ:ZZ:ZZ:ZZ:ZZ:ZZ
|
||||
# ...
|
||||
# saveenv
|
||||
|
||||
Where XX:XX:XX:XX:XX:XX is permanent ethernet MAC address.
|
||||
Where value for ethaddr is required permanent ethernet MAC address and values for ethNaddr
|
||||
are optional per-port MAC addresses. When optional ethNaddr variables are not defined then
|
||||
they are inherited from required ethaddr variable. eth1addr contains MAC address for the
|
||||
wan port, other for particular lan ports.
|
||||
|
||||
Recent Linux kernel versions use correct permanent ethernet MAC address from U-Boot env as
|
||||
U-Boot will inject it into kernel's device-tree.
